spi: bcmbca-hsspi: switch to use modern name
authorYang Yingliang <yangyingliang@huawei.com>
Mon, 7 Aug 2023 12:40:58 +0000 (20:40 +0800)
committerMark Brown <broonie@kernel.org>
Mon, 14 Aug 2023 12:10:59 +0000 (13:10 +0100)
Change legacy name master to modern name host or controller.

No functional changed.
